We worked closely with the Bioproducts Discovery and Development Centre (BDDC) located at Canada’s University of Guelph, conducting the key research and innovation that helped create PURPOD100®. This centre of innovation brings together world-class, interdisciplinary experts to collaborate on projects with commercial application. It’s brings together the best of academia with industry to create innovative solutions with real-world applications.

We worked with a variety of key partners to develop other central components that make PURPOD100® the #rightsolution, such as, the first commercially compostable† mesh of its kind in the world. Additional experiments identified an opportunity to use the thin skin that comes from roasting coffee beans to give the ring on every PURPOD100® its distinctive brown look“, while helping to promote a circular economy and divert waste from landfill.

The US Composting Council

The US Composting Council is involved in research, training, public education, composting and compost standards, expansion of compost markets and the enlistment of public support. It provides resources, educational materials, training, networking, and career advancement opportunities for professionals and all those affiliated with the composting and organics recycling industry. USCC members include compost producers, equipment manufacturers, product suppliers, academic institutions, public agencies, nonprofit groups and consulting/engineering firms.

PAC, Packaging Consortium

PAC, Packaging Consortium drives for progressive change in the packaging value chain through leadership, collaboration and knowledge sharing. It is determined to lead the packaging discussion to help contribute to action on reducing food waste. It has founded PAC FOOD WASTE, mandated to be “A Catalyst for Food Waste Packaging Solutions” because smart and sustainable production and packaging technologies can help to improve the supply of food. It is linked to PAC NEXT which is pursuing a vision of “A World Without Packaging Waste.”

The Compost Council of Canada

The Compost Council of Canada is a national non-profit, member-driven organization with a charter to advocate and advance organics residuals recycling and compost use. It serves as the central resource and network for the compost industry in Canada and, through its members, contributes to the environmental sustainability of the communities in which they operate.
